KPMG is currently seeking a Manager, SALT Income Franchise - Consulting to join our State and Local Tax (SALT) practice.

Responsibilities

  • Work as part of a national multi-disciplinary state income tax consulting team helping clients with their most complex state tax issues, including organizational structure optimization, identifying refund opportunities, developing and delivering technology solutions, and general consulting matters
  • Lead state tax return review engagements focused on identifying and securing state income tax refunds
  • Assist multi-national companies with state and local tax controversies which includes preparing clients for discussions with auditors, representing the client at hearings and appeal meetings, and preparing protests
  • Review technical memoranda or slide decks regarding income, franchise, sales and use tax, and other state and local tax questions
  • Build and manage client relationships and supervise, mentor, and develop associates

Requirements

  • Minimum five years of recent experience performing tax research, assisting with state income tax return review projects, managing restructuring engagements and providing technical advice on multi-state income tax issues
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college/university; CPA, EA or JD/LLM in addition to others on KPMG's approved credential listing; any individual who does not possess at least one of the approved designations/credentials when their employment commences, has one year from their date of hire to obtain at least one of the approved designations/credentials
  • Demonstrated ability to lead teams delivering state and local income tax consulting services
  • Ability to develop business and foster relationships both internally as well as with clients
  • Excellent writing, compliance, communication, management, and tax research skills
  • Capability and desire to perform in a high-energy team environment
